Ekambareswarar Temple

  • Explore the vast Ekambareswarar Temple complex dedicated to Lord Shiva.
  • Discover one of the Pancha Bhoota Stalams representing the element Earth.
  • Admire the towering gopuram, detailed sculptures, and the sacred ancient mango tree believed to be over 3,500 years old.

Kailasanathar Temple

  • Visit the oldest temple in Kanchipuram, built by the Pallava kings in the eighth century.
  • Observe early Dravidian architectural features, sandstone carvings, miniature shrines, and the peaceful inner courtyard.

Vaikunta Perumal Temple

  • Continue to the Vaikunta Perumal Temple dedicated to Lord Vishnu.
  • View the unique three-tiered sanctum depicting the deity in sitting, standing, and reclining forms.
  • Study stone inscriptions and sculpted panels illustrating Pallava history.

Varadaraja Perumal Temple

  • Visit one of the 108 Divya Desams sacred to Lord Vishnu.
  • Walk through the expansive temple complex spread across 23 acres.
  • Admire the majestic gopurams, the hundred-pillared hall, intricate carvings, and the sacred temple pond.
